Meredith Rae Mauldin (née Thompson; born August 11, 1980), better known by her stage name Meredith McCoy, is an American voice actress and singer working for Funimation. McCoy has done national commercials for Radio Shack, AT&T, 7-Eleven, and Chevrolet.
